Stephen F. Austin was arrested in Saltillo, Mexico, in 1833 due to his efforts to negotiate greater autonomy for Texas within Mexico. He had traveled to Mexico City to present a petition for reforms, but upon his arrival, political tensions were high, and the Mexican government viewed his actions with suspicion. Austin was detained for several months, accused of being part of a conspiracy against the Mexican government, but he was eventually released and returned to Texas. His arrest heightened tensions between Texan settlers and the Mexican authorities, contributing to the eventual Texas Revolution.
